this class has a bunch of responsibilities and state transitions. e.g. it has an "invalid" state. modules can be built, not built yet, not buildable, etc. I think it can be simpler if decomposed into: - `struct ModuleFile`, which has a module name, a filename, and deletes the file in its destructor - `class PrerequisiteModules` which owns a set of `ModuleFiles` for a particular TU, and knows how to adjust the compile commands etc to use them - a function to build `PrerequisiteModules` for a TU. This is currently `static PrerequisiteModules::buildPrerequisiteModulesFor` which is OK, but it can really just create a bunch of `ModuleFile`s and pass it to the PrerequisiteModules constructor. (As I mention elsewhere: I think buildPrerquisiteModulesFor should really be a method on a different `ModuleBuilder` object, as it will eventually need to deal with caching and other things) https://github.com/llvm/llvm-project/pull/66462 _______________________________________________ cfe-commits mailing list cfe-commits@lists.llvm.org https://lists.llvm.org/cgi-bin/mailman/listinfo/cfe-commits
